Service Overview
Commercial polished concrete flooring can turn an existing slab into a durable, lower-maintenance finished floor without introducing a completely separate flooring assembly. It is often chosen where owners want longevity, a cleaner visual profile, and a finish that can stand up to active use.
Showcase Finishing Systems handles concrete polishing and sealing scopes for commercial interiors, large operational spaces, corridors, retail floors, education projects, and selected residential environments across New Jersey, Greater Philadelphia, and the Northeast.
In practice, the best polished concrete work starts with an honest read of the slab itself, because gloss goals, repair visibility, aggregate exposure, and maintenance expectations all change the right recommendation.

Frequently Asked Questions
Polished concrete flooring is typically chosen when a project needs durability, lower long-term maintenance, light reflectivity, and a clean finished appearance in a space that cannot be treated like a basic finish-only floor replacement.
Polished concrete flooring is commonly used in hangars, large commercial interiors, retail floors, education facilities, corridors, and existing slab renovations throughout New Jersey, Greater Philadelphia, and the Northeast.
Owners usually choose this system when they need durability, lower long-term maintenance, light reflectivity, and a clean finished appearance without compromising the way the space has to operate every day.
A polished or sealed concrete floor can perform for a long time when the slab is suitable, the finish is installed correctly, and maintenance is aligned with the use of the space.
Installation time depends on slab condition, desired sheen, repairs, square footage, and whether the work is phased around active operations.
Downtime is usually driven by prep, repair, polishing sequence, and any protection or sealer cure time needed before the space is opened back up.
Preparation often includes grinding, coating removal, joint repair, crack work, stain removal, and evaluating whether the slab can deliver the target finish level.
If the existing floor finish can be removed and the slab beneath it is worth restoring, sometimes yes. The right answer depends on the actual slab condition.
Slip performance depends on the finish level, maintenance, contaminants, and where the floor is used. That should be evaluated around the real operating environment.
Maintenance typically focuses on dust control, proper cleaner selection, regular auto-scrubbing where appropriate, and avoiding products that leave residue on the finish.
Yes. Polished concrete is widely used in commercial, institutional, and public-facing environments.
Yes, in many industrial and operational spaces, though the final recommendation depends on traffic type, abuse level, and maintenance conditions.
Yes. Gloss, aggregate exposure, dyes, and sealer options can all influence the final look.
The best comparison usually turns on traffic, substrate condition, maintenance goals, moisture exposure, finish expectations, and schedule. We compare those conditions directly so the decision is based on the job, not a generic material preference.
Polished and sealed concrete can perform well, but the correct system still depends on exposure to chemicals, moisture, and operational abuse. Some environments may need a different flooring strategy.
Many slabs can be repaired and blended as part of the polishing process, though visible repair conditions depend on the existing concrete and the finish target.
Repair scope, coating removal, slab condition, desired sheen, aggregate exposure, square footage, and phasing all affect polished concrete pricing.
